Original Message:   Somebody got it backwards....
I found this strand at an antique gallery. The tag says the beads are "Fimo glass". A lot of the earlier Fimo beads were made using techniques similar to Venetian trade beads, but this person seems to think this glass was inspired by Fimo techniques....??

The center bead is about 12mm, and the rest are quite small. I see amber chips, green hearts, tile beads?? except they're shiny and I've only seen matte ones before, a small version of the crumb bead from earlier threads, small Venetians...
